Part 2- Other Information We Collect:

Web Beacons are electronic files that allow a web site to count users who have visited that page or to access certain cookies. When you receive email messages or newsletters from us, we may use web beacons, customized links or similar technologies to determine whether the e-mail has been opened and which links you click in order to provide you more focused e-mail communications or other information.

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your hard disk by a Web page server. Cookies contain information that can later be read by a Web server in the domain that issued the cookie to you. Cookies cannot be used to run programs or deliver viruses to your computer. Like many other web sites, Ziff Davis sites use cookies to enable you to sign in to our services and to help personalize your online experience. We may use a cookie to identify members so they do not have to re-enter a user ID and password when they wish to download a utility, post to a discussion, or sign into an account. As another example, cookies can be used to control the number of times you see advertisements, like pop-ups. By allowing us to better understand how users interact with the site over time, cookies can also help us improve your experience and deliver more relevant content to you. Cookies may be created directly by our sites for these purposes, or by third-party companies operating on our behalf.

Pixel Tags, also known as clear gifs, beacons, spotlight tags or web bugs, are a method for passing information from the user's computer to a third party Web site. Used in conjunction with cookies, Ziff Davis may use pixel tags to improve our understanding of site traffic, visitor behavior, and response to promotional campaigns. Pixel tags are also used as a supplement to our server logs and other methods of traffic and response measurement, and are sometimes used in conjunction with small Javascript-based applications. We may also implement pixel tags provided by other companies for the same purpose. We use clear gifs in our HTML based emails to let us know which emails have been opened by recipients.

You need not have cookies turned on to visit all of our sites, though cookies may be required in order for you to participate in certain areas. If you choose to become a member of certain Ziff Davis websites, you must have cookies enabled to access any member related pages (i.e., Discussion Boards, Member Profile pages, Search for a Member).

IP Addresses are a unique string of numbers that identifies each computer attached to the Internet. We use IP Addresses to analyze trends, administer our web sites, track users' movement, and gather broad demographic information for aggregate use. IP addresses that we collect are sometimes linked to personally identifiable information. We use registration and email addresses that you provide together with IP Addresses and other information we collect as described in this policy, to understand our customer base and to market services and products to our customers.

Interest-based Ads: We use cookies, Javascript, pixel tags and other technology to collect information about your visit (“Online Data”) to our sites and other third party partner websites that we do not own or operate but with whom we have agreements. We analyze what pages you visit on our sites and the third party sites, what products or services you view, and whether you view or click on ads that are shown to you. We use this information to send you interest based ads. All such data is also collected anonymously, and is aggregated with other data we collect and/or similar data collected by partners to create segments, groups of users and certain general interest categories or segments that we have inferred based on (a) demographic or interest data, and a general geographic location derived from your IP address, (b) the pages you view and links you click when using our sites and services and those of our partners, and/or (c) the search terms you enter when using certain search services. We use this information to get a more accurate picture of audience interests in order to serve ads we believe are more relevant to your interests.

We store page views, clicks and search terms used for ad personalization targeting separately from your contact information or other data that directly identifies you (such as your name, e-mail address) which we obtained as described above under Personal Information and in some situations we combine the two sets of data.

We will engage third party providers to assist with the collection, storage and segmentation of this Online Data; and the providers are required to maintain the confidentiality of this information. These efforts do not result in the collection of personally identifiable information such as name or address; and we do not intentionally collect data that we consider to be sensitive such as health or medical information. This data is not sold or transferred to any third party. Except as may be set forth elsewhere in this policy, this Online Data is retained for not more than 180 days after which it shall expire except in certain situations when the same user subsequently visits one of our sites or a partner's site in which event the 180 day period will commence again.
